Output 6587031eb16b7695fafda9b649e89f88b7adffb7e01a9670ed62786f01bb4eb3:1

value
2638298
script pubkey
OP_0 OP_PUSHBYTES_32 b40ef2fde5bb86e66c9ffa9905e73b26ba6c409f5ec3b2ec8c44c4eb335279d4
address
bc1qks809l09hwrwvmyll2vsteemy6axcsyltmpm9myvgnzwkv6j082quqns3e
transaction
6587031eb16b7695fafda9b649e89f88b7adffb7e01a9670ed62786f01bb4eb3